Sacombank, officially known as Saigon Thuong Tin Commercial Joint Stock Bank, has disclosed that two of its Vice Presidents, Ho Doan Cuong and Nguyen Minh Tam, will be leaving their positions effective July 31, 2026. According to the official announcement, the decision to terminate their contracts was made in accordance with their personal wishes.
Both executives, born in 1972, will not hold any other positions within the bank following their resignation. They are required to complete the handover of assets, tools, and relevant work responsibilities before their departure and will receive severance packages as per current regulations.
Following their exit, the management team of Sacombank will be led by Faussier Loic Michel Marc, who was officially appointed as the bank's General Director on July 10, 2026. The current executive team also includes eight Vice Presidents and two other members.
